// MAX_SCALE_FACTOR caps how far PantryPilot's recipe-scaling engine will
// multiply ingredient quantities before rounding errors in fractional
// units (teaspoons, pinches) become noticeable. Marisol benchmarked this
// against the Veldt test corpus and found drift above 48x. Do not raise
// it without re-running the rounding suite. The value was frozen in the build noted below.

session token of tajef-bageg = htk21_5d90d574934f3ccae6437

Handover Note — Q2 Cash-Flow Forecast

Rowan,

Handing over the forecast file. Short version: receipts from the Tessler contract slip a month, so we're tight in weeks six through nine but fine after. Department heads should hold discretionary spend until then. Assumptions are in the model; nothing heroic. The bigger picture is in the confidential note below.

confidential, bahap-bajog: Zorethix Works is in early talks to buy Kelethox Foods for about $30.7 million. The Ralvan launch date is September 19, and nothing goes to the press before then.

Release checklist — item 7: Ticket-pricing experiment (Project Lanthorn)

Before enabling the dynamic-pricing variant for Quillfare event tickets, confirm the holdout group sees legacy prices only, verify refunds route through the old flow, and note that support macros must quote the price shown at purchase time, never the current listing. Escalate any double-charge reports immediately. The build under test is recorded below.

build token for kagaf-hahof: htk14_9d3d4d26d7d8de

## Deployment

Welcome aboard! We're carving the user module out of the old Brindlewick monolith into its own service, `userhive`. Deploys go through the usual pipeline, but `userhive` needs its own config before the first rollout, or it'll crash-loop on startup. Copy these values into your environment before deploying.

service settings:
[casax]
port = 6379
team = rusir
host = casax.zemvarhq.corp
region = outer-4
access_code = ac_9808ce
timeout_ms = 1500